[0017] Referring to the drawings, in which like reference characters designate like or similar elements, figure 1 is a top view of an exemplary embodiment of a solar panel cleaning system according to the present invention, with some details of the system omitted for simplicity and clarity.

[0018] An exemplary solar panel cleaning system is shown in conjunction with a row of solar panel assemblies 111 (hereinafter referred to as "solar row"). Solar row 111 includes a plurality of solar panels of virtually any type and configuration known to those skilled in the art. For example, a single solar panel will typically have a face area of ​​less than about one square meter. The length of the solar row 111 can vary from about a few meters to about a few kilometers. The width of the solar row 111 ranges from about one meter to about several meters.

Abstract

System and method for cleaning solar panel rows, with electronic descent control and potential energy recovery system, operating by modulated switching signals to an electronic switching device that converts DC output of a DC motor / generator to alternating current that is transferred through a transformer and rectifier to charge the system's battery. An impedance load on the DC motor / generator is generated during downward movement of the system' s cleaning apparatus in order to control the descent rate of the cleaning apparatus.

technical field [0001] The present invention relates to a ramp down control and energy recovery system for a solar panel cleaning system. Background of the invention [0002] The challenges of global climate change and the need for energy security have made the development of renewable energy alternatives critical to our future. Using direct solar radiation on solar panels could potentially generate enough energy to meet the world's needs. As the price of solar energy falls and the price of conventional fuels rises, the solar energy industry has entered a new era of global growth. [0003] In order to bring solar technology one step closer to petroleum, the utility rate must be increased. [0004] Solar panel surfaces are made of high-quality glass, and the efficiency with which they generate renewable energy depends (among other things) on the cleanliness of the glass surface.
